14. Independent Capacit . Each party to this Agreement shall act in an independent capacity and <br />not as an agent or representative of the other party. The employees or agents of each party <br />who are engaged in the performance of this Agreement shall continue to be the employees or <br />agents of that party, and shall not be considered for any purpose to be the employees or agents <br />of the other party, except in regard to the Shared Epidemiologist, as described herein. GCHD <br />shall not be obligated to pay the Shared Epidemiologist and the Shared Epidemiologist shall not <br />be entitled to any benefits accorded to GCHD employees by virtue of the services provided <br />under this Agreement. <br />15. Severability. If any provision of this Agreement shall be held invalid, such invalidity shall not <br />affect the other provisions of this Agreement that can be given effect without the invalid <br />provision, if such remainder is consistent with applicable law and with the fundamental purpose <br />of this Agreement, and to this end the provisions of this Agreement are declared to be <br />severable. <br />16. Waiver. The waiver by a party of any default or breach of this Agreement, or the failure of a <br />party to enforce any provision hereof or to exercise any right or privilege hereunder, shall not be <br />deemed to waive any prior or subsequent breach or default, the enforcement of any provision <br />hereof, or the exercise of any right or privilege hereunder, unless otherwise stated in a signed <br />writing by the party granting such waiver. <br />17. Disputes. In the event of a dispute between the parties relating to this Agreement, the parties <br />agree to make a good faith attempt to resolve such dispute informally, prior to the <br />commencement of any legal action or arbitration. <br />18. Govern inR. Law. This Agreement shall be governed by the laws of the State of Washington. <br />19. Force Maieure. In the event of a forced delay in performance by a party of its obligations under <br />this Agreement, due to causes beyond that party's reasonable control, including but not limited <br />to natural disasters, epidemics, embargoes, war, insurrection, riots, or strikes, such party's time <br />for performance under this Agreement shall be extended for the period of the forced delay. <br />20. Entire Agreement. This Agreement constitutes the entire agreement between the parties and <br />supersedes any and all other agreements, understandings, negotiations and discussions, oral or <br />written, express or implied, relating to the subject matter hereof. <br />IN WITNESS WHEREOF, this Agreement has been executed by and on behalf of the parties through their <br />authorized representatives, effective as of the latest date written below. <br />Interlocal Agreement <br />Page 6 of 9 <br />
